Setting Up OpenCMIS Server Development Guide code in IntelliJ

To complete this guide we assume you have a computer with a Mac OSX / MacOS operating system and the IntelliJ IDEA IDE already installed.

To initiate the OpenCMIS Server Development Guide project setup, please, download ServerDevelopmentGuide latest source code from https://github.com/cmisdocs/. There are two different versions of the Server Development Guide. This guide uses version 1 to illustrate the configuration process, however, the configuration process is the same for both versions. Figure 1 shows CMIS Docs GitHub page. To proceed to the download page, please, click the ServerDevelopmentGuide link.

Figure 1 - CMIS Docs GitHub Page

To download the ServerDevelopmentGuide source code, please, click the "Clone or download" button, identified in Figure 2 with the number 1, and choose the "Download ZIP" option. The code should be downloaded to your computer.

Figure 2 - Download OpenCMIS server Development Guide

Extract the ZIP file contents to a folder in your computer. Please, bear in mind the folder you choose will be your project working folder. We suggest placing the OpenCMIS Server Development Guide project folder inside the "/Users/<username>/" folder, as illustrated by Figure 3.

Figure 3 - ServerDevelopmentGuide-master Project Folder

Open IntelliJ IDEA IDE and from the initial screen, illustrated by Figure 4, choose the "Open" option. Next, select "cmisFileBridge-master" folder inside the "ServerDevelopmentGuide-master" project folder location and click the "Open" button.

Figure 4 - IntelliJ Open Project

On opening the project, the IntelliJ IDEA IDE will automatically detect the presence of frameworks and prompt you for its configuration. To access the configuration window and setup the project frameworks, please click the "Configure" link, in blue, as shown by Figure 5.

Figure 5 - IntelliJ Frameworks Detected

To automatically configure the detected frameworks, select the checkboxes behind each framework presented and click the "OK" button. Figure 6 presents the frameworks detected by IntelliJ IDEA IDE for the OpenCMIS Server Development Guide project.

Figure 6 - IntelliJ Framework Setup

The project will be detected as a Maven project by the IDE and all needed dependencies will also be indexed and automatically downloaded. The dependencies download may take some time, depending on the your internet connection speed. Figure 7 shows IntelliJ IDE "Background Tasks" window resolving the project dependencies.

Figure 7 - IntelliJ Resolving Dependencies

After the frameworks configuration and dependencies resolving, the project is finally set up inside IntelliJ. If the process went well, you should be seeing the "cmisFileBridge-master [server]" project file tree like the one shown in Figure 8. The "cmisFileBridge-master" project is the server example code for the OpenCMIS Server Development Guide project.

Figure 8 - CMIS File Bridge Project Tree in IntelliJ
